My name is Kerena Clifton and I teach middle school math and robotics. I was born in Idaho, graduated high school from Murtaugh, and went to college for 1 1/2 years in Virginia. I then returned home to finish up my associates degree at CSI. I always wanted to be a teacher and was working towards that before getting married and having kids. I still wanted to work in the school setting while I was raising my two boys, so I started working as a Paraprofessional in 2013. Throughout the 8 years I have worked in almost every grade level from high school to preschool. I learned so much from being in many different classrooms with different ages, different teachers and working with a variety of students. Last year, I decided I wanted to do more to help educate the students and started college again to finish up my teaching degree, then applied for this position. I am currently finsihing up my bachelors in education with WGU and am excited to help the students at RISE learn math.  I really like the Summit curriculum, it brings deep thought and discussion into the classrooms and I am excited about where it will take us. 

Math and problem solving is something I really enjoy. I hope to instill some of that joy into my students. Even though I liked parts of math when I was younger, I struggled with it at first. I had a teacher in college pull me aside and show me things I had never learned before. Math finally started to make sense and I love the challenge of it now. I know how it feels to struggle and not feel confident in my skills and can empathize with kids that may be experiencing the same thing. I was one of them!  One of my goals is to help them see that they don't have to be "good" at math to be successful with it. I want them to know that mistakes are just a step in the learning process and if they are willing to work hard, be resilient, and persistent they can acheive whatever they set out to do, including math.
